MID-CENTURY CRAFTSMAN GEM   Designed by Berkeley landmark architect, John B. Anthony, best known for his art deco buildings, this lovely four bedroom, three bath home is one of his few designed in the mid-century vein.  Built c. 1940, it is an unusual, striking combination of mid-century lines with extensive craftsman details.  The post-and-beam construction allows for large open spaces and walls of windows that frame perfect views of the Golden Gate, the Berkeley hills and the lush garden in both the living/dining room and the master bedroom.  But unlike many stark mid-century homes, this one features walls and ceilings wrapped in pale, unfinished mahogany with carefully crafted details in the trim, exposed box beams and railings, a feature that highlights the lush views visible just outside.  Well-sited on one-third acres of grounds, many rooms open to lovely garden spots.  The magical, gardens terrace down the hillside, past a waterfall, a pond, lush beds of annuals and flowering trees and both a spa and a fire pit.  Two large stone patios offer plenty of space for outdoor eating and entertaining and a tiled deck off the master offers a private outdoor retreat.  A covered walkway provides level access from the garage to the upstairs bedrooms. Recent renovations include all-new kitchen, electrical system, drainage, as well as all garden landscaping.
